Preparation and Cooking Time
Preparing Chicken Caprese Skillet is quick and efficient. Here’s a breakdown of the time you’ll need to allocate:
– Preparation Time: 10 minutes
– Cooking Time: 20 minutes
– Total Time: 30 minutes

Ingredients
– 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
– 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1 cup fresh mozzarella cheese, diced
– 1 cup fresh basil leaves, torn
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– 1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ar (optional)
– Salt and pepper, to taste
Step-by-Step Instructions
Creating Chicken Caprese Skillet is a breeze when you follow these straightforward steps:
1. Heat the Skillet: In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
2. Season the Chicken: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per on both sides.
3. Cook the Chicken: Add the chicken to the skillet and cook for about 6-7 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through.
4. Add Garlic: Once the chicken is nearly done, add the min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for 1 minute until fragrant.
5. Incorporate Tomatoes: Stir in the halved cherry tomatoes and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es, allowing them to soften and release their juices.
6. Add Mozzarella: Sprinkle the diced mozzarella over the chicken and cover the skillet. Cook for another 2-3 minutes until the cheese is melted.
7. Finish with Basil: Remove the skillet from heat and stir in the torn basil leaves. Drizzle with balsamic vinegar if desired.
8. Serve: Plate the chicken and spoon the tomato and cheese mixture over the top. Enjoy!

Additional Tips
– Use Fresh Ingredients: To maximize flavor, opt for fresh basil, ripe tomatoes, and high-quality mozzarella.
– Marinate the Chicken: For an extra layer of flavor, consider marinating the chicken in olive oil, garlic, and herbs for 30 minutes before cooking.
– Adjust Seasonings: Feel free to modify the salt and pepper levels according to your taste preferences. You could also add red pepper flakes for a spicy kick.
Recipe Variation
There are countless ways to customize your Chicken Caprese Skillet. Here are some ideas:
1. Add Vegetables: Incorporate bell peppers, zucchini, or spinach for added nutrition and color.
2. Pasta Option: Serve it over cooked pasta for a heartier meal. Toss the pasta in the skillet during the last few minutes of cooking.
3. Herb Swaps: Experiment with other herbs like oregano or thyme to alter the flavor profile.
Freezing and Storage
– Storage: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
– Freezing: You can freeze the Chicken Caprese Skillet for up to 2 months. Ensure it is properly cooled before transferring to a freezer-safe container. Th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use chicken thighs instead of breasts?
Yes, chicken thighs can be a flavorful alternative. They may take a bit longer to cook through, so check for doneness.
What if I don’t have cherry tomatoes?
You can use diced large tomatoes or even sun-dried tomatoes for a different flavor.
Is this recipe gluten-free?
Yes, Chicken Caprese Skillet is naturally gluten-free. Just ensure that any additional ingredients you use are also gluten-free.
Can I make this dish ahead of time?
While it’s best enjoyed fresh, you can prep the ingredients in advance. Cook the chicken and store it separately from the sauce until ready to serve.
How do I know when the chicken is fully cooked?
The internal temperature of the chicken should reach 165°F (75°C). You can use a meat thermometer to check.
